The Rabbit Polyclonal anti-Neuregulin 4 antibody is suitable to detect Neuregulin 4 in samples from Human and Mouse. It has been validated for WB and ELISA.
Optimal working dilutions should be determined experimentally by the investigator. Suggested starting dilutions are as follows: WB 1:500-2000,ELISA 1:5000-20000

Storage Comment
Stable for one year at -20°C from date of shipment.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ing.

Background
Pro-neuregulin-4, membrane-bound isoform, Pro-NRG4NRG4 (Neuregulin 4) is a Protein Coding gene. Among its related pathways are RET signaling and Signaling by ERBB2. GO annotations related to this gene include receptor binding and growth factor activity. Low affinity ligand for the ERBB4 tyrosine kinase receptor. Concomitantly recruits ERBB1 and ERBB2 coreceptors, resulting in ligand-stimulated tyrosine phosphorylation and activation of the ERBB receptors. Does not bind to the ERBB1, ERBB2 and ERBB3 receptors (By similarity).
